Why Does Franchise SEO in Champaign Require a Different Approach?

Most franchise agreements give corporate control over your domain, your meta data, and sometimes even your Google Business Profile. That means your Champaign location might be living on a subdirectory like brand.com/champaign-il — a page that gets almost no unique local content, no locally earned backlinks, and zero signals that differentiate you from a location in Peoria or Springfield.

Champaign is home to the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, which creates a market that cycles heavily — new students arrive every August, tens of thousands of visitors flood campus on football weekends, and entire neighborhoods like Robeson Meadows, Devonshire, and Countryside see seasonal demand spikes that a corporate content calendar will never account for. A franchise SEO strategy built for Champaign has to be built around Champaign.

The Multi-Location Duplicate Content Trap

When a franchise has dozens of locations, corporate often publishes the same page template for every city, swapping only the location name. Google recognizes this pattern and suppresses the pages. Your Champaign location page needs genuinely original content — references to local landmarks like the Virginia Theatre or the Champaign-Urbana Farmers Market, locally relevant FAQs, and citations from Champaign-area directories — or it will continue to underperform no matter how strong the national brand is.

What Does Local Search Actually Look Like for Champaign Franchise Owners?

Search behavior in Champaign skews heavily toward mobile, partly because of the student and young-professional population. “Near me” queries peak on weekends and during university events. Your Google Business Profile (GBP) for the Champaign location — not the corporate website — is often the first thing a potential customer sees. If that profile has thin content, outdated hours, or is claimed under a corporate account that never gets localized attention, you’re invisible at the exact moment someone is ready to buy.

Local competitors — whether they’re independent businesses or other franchise locations in nearby Urbana, Savoy, or Rantoul — are competing for the same three map pack spots. The difference between showing up and not showing up is almost entirely in the signals you control: your GBP completeness, the quality of your location page, and the local backlinks pointing to that specific location.

Technical SEO for Franchise Sites

Franchise websites frequently have structural issues: duplicate title tags across location pages, improper canonical tags pointing the wrong direction, or hreflang errors on multi-location sites. We audit the technical foundation of your Champaign location presence and work with your corporate IT contact to resolve anything that’s suppressing your visibility.

Frequently Asked Questions: Franchise SEO in Champaign, Illinois

Can I do local SEO if my franchise controls my website?

Yes. Even under strict franchise agreements, there are almost always local signals you control: your Google Business Profile, local citations, review management, and sometimes a location-specific content section. A franchise SEO specialist identifies which levers are available and maximizes them within your agreement’s constraints.

How long does franchise SEO take to show results in Champaign?

Most Champaign franchise locations see measurable movement — improved local rankings, more GBP views, increased website clicks — within three to five months of sustained optimization. Competitive categories can take longer, but the work compounds over time in ways that paid ads do not.

Why isn’t my national brand’s authority helping my Champaign location rank?

National domain authority helps the brand’s homepage and category pages rank for broad terms. Local searches trigger a separate local algorithm that weighs proximity, local relevance, and GBP signals — none of which are automatically inherited by individual franchise location pages without dedicated local optimization.

Should each franchise location have its own Google Business Profile?

Yes, every physical franchise location should have its own verified, fully optimized Google Business Profile. A single shared profile or a profile claimed under a generic corporate account will almost always underperform compared to a properly managed, location-specific profile.

What makes Champaign’s market different from other Illinois cities?

Champaign’s market is shaped heavily by the University of Illinois — a 50,000-student institution that creates annual population cycles, demand spikes around academic events, and a younger-than-average mobile-first search audience. These dynamics affect keyword seasonality, review velocity expectations, and content strategy in ways that a generic franchise SEO template will completely miss.

Do I need a separate SEO strategy for each of my franchise locations?

Each location needs its own localized content, citation profile, and GBP management — but they can share an overall strategic framework. The key is that the local signals for your Champaign location must be distinct from your Urbana or Savoy location. Identical content across locations triggers duplicate content issues that hurt all of them.
